CHANNEL HEALTH WINS SKY DIGITAL £1.2M DEAL

DIGITAL television company Channel Health have won a £1.2 million contract to run a pilot interactive television service on pregnancy for the NHS.
The company, which floated on AIM last August, will produce seven half-hour programmes for broadcast on Sky Digital.
The series will not only provide entertainment and informative viewing, but will demonstrate in the most concrete terms how a range of services, including information phone lines, email user groups, digital TV and NHS Direct can be used to give the patient greater control over the provision of their healthcare services.
Joanne Sawicki, Chief Executive of Channel Health said: “The award of the NHS contract is a milestone few companies could expect to achieve at such an early stage of development.
“Moreover, it is proof positive of our conviction in the Channel Health model. This is a ground breaking project and we are proud to be involved in the NHS’ determination to lead the way in the development of digital TV in the health arena”.
Channel Health is the lead contractor to the NHS for this project. One of its key strategic partners in the contract is Bounty SCA. This alliance will enable Channel Health branded materials to reach 80 per cent of new mothers in the UK, via the Bounty sample packs distributed to new mothers in hospital delivery rooms throughout the UK.
Commenting on the NHS’s commitment to digital information revolution, Health Minister Gisela Stuart, said: “Digital TV promises faster, easier access to health information for all and is likely to allow us to take a further significant step towards the NHS becoming the authoritative provider of advice on health at home and a proactive partner in helping people to change to healthier lifestyles.” (AMcE)
